1992 Ford F-350 service brakes, hydraulic problems
10 owner complaints filed with NHTSA name the service brakes, hydraulic on the 1992 Ford F-350 — 19% of all complaints for this model year.
What owners report
“When applying the brakes the pedal goes to the floor and vehicle does not stop. Owner has to downshift and use emergency brake to stop. Brake calipers had to be rplaced and defect still exists. Defect mainly occurs on declines. *ak”
filed Mar 25, 1999
“When traveling the power assist belt came off, causing loss of power steering/power brakes and loss of vehicle control, resulting in a near accident. Consumer has contacted the dealer. Dealer has replaced parts. Please provide any further details. *ak”
filed Jul 8, 1998
Verbatim excerpts from complaints filed with NHTSA. Reports are not independently verified.
